Market neutral strategies have gained attention for their potential to deliver positive returns regardless of the direction of underlying markets. As these strategies have built a record of good performance in recent years, their benefits have become apparent. Market Neutral Strategies draws on the wisdom and experience of professional practitioners to describe strategies that are being utilized by some of today’s leading institutional investors.

Introduction:

This book provides a forum in which some of the industry’s leading market neutral practitioners discuss the implementation, the benefits, and the risks of market neutral investing. The discussion is directed toward institutional investors, sophisticated individual investors, and investment consultants who seek a deeper understanding of how these strategies can contribute to the pursuit of investment return and the
control of investment risk.

In this context, the book assumes that readers are familiar with basic investment concepts and practices. Every attempt has been made, however, to explain these strategies in plain English, with minimal resort to mathematics or arcane financial theory. This book focuses on five market neutral strategies:

  • Market neutral equity
  • Convertible bond arbitrage
  • Government bond arbitrage
  • Mortgage-backed securities arbitrage
  • Merger arbitrage

These strategies fall within a broad definition of arbitrage in the sense that each makes use of instruments that are related in some fundamental way. The equities held long and sold short in equity market neutral portfolios, for example, are fundamentally related through their exposures to the broad underlying market, while the bonds and fixed-income derivatives used in sovereign fixed-income arbitrage are fundamentally related through their exposures to interest rate movements, and the instruments employed in merger arbitrage are related through the expected convergence of the two companies’ share prices. These strategies have also developed performance histories and liquidity adequate for institutional investors.
